Rasht; Death of Mohammadreza Mansouri After 25 Days due to Severe Injuries

Mohammadreza Mansouri, a 26-year-old Kurdish Khorasani (Kurmanj) resident of Rasht, was one of those injured during the nationwide protests on Friday, January 9, 2026. He was seriously wounded after being directly shot with pellet ammunition by Iranian security forces and died after 25 days of suffering from his injuries.

According to Kolbarnews, Mohammadreza Mansouri was transferred to Poursina Hospital in Rasht and received medical treatment, but the severity of his injuries prevented doctors from saving his life. He ultimately died on February 2, 2026.

According to received information, Mohammadreza Mansouri had recently become a father, and his child was only two months old. His body was buried under strict security measures and with limited family presence at Baghe Rezvan Cemetery in Rasht.

Reports also indicate that security pressures on the family and restrictions on holding funeral ceremonies have raised concerns about continued security measures against the families of those killed during the protests.
